Our History

Eklavya Model Residential Schools (EMRSs) is a flagship intervention of the Ministry of Tribal Affairs, Government of India to provide quality residential education to Scheduled Tribes students from Class 6th to 12th in remote areas to enable them to access the best opportunities in education and to bring them at par with the general population. The programme has been in operation since 1998 and was revamped during the year 2018-19 to expand the geographical outreach and enhance the quality of facilities.

Affiliated to the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) and strictly following the NCERT curriculum, the school serves students from Classes I to XII with Science, Commerce, and Arts streams at the Senior Secondary level.
